He’s the president, and as such can make executive orders regarding the naming practices of federally regulated entities in the United States, such as the Coast Guard, and, more to the point, the U.S. Board on Geographic Names, and its Domestic Names Committee, which is part of the Department of the Interior. Trump has done this sort of thing before, as in Executive Order 14172, known as “Restoring Names That Honor American Greatness,” which was passed on the day of his second inauguration last year.
